(haven't checked to see if others have replied) They're almost gone in the US. On my plan, I can still get subsidized phones, but they are much more expensive for the monthly charge for the line. I had to upgrade my (AT&T) plan to get the new pricing, though.
My Verizon bill has gone down as a result.
 
In my experience specifically, with the old two-year contract at the end of two years the price for the line didn't drop. When I switched to a plan with unsubsidized phones, the price immediately dropped significantly, and if I opted to purchase a phone from AT&T on one of their payment plans, that plan ends when the payments are over. More transparent, better.

I don't understand the upgrade program. It costs £33.45/m here in the UK and it says that's based on £718 over 20 months 0% p.a. But the iPhone 7 costs £599. Where are they getting £718 from? It says 0% p.a so is it possible the punishment for paying in instalments is an inflated price?
It includes AppleCare which cost £119
